There is no universally 'best' supply model—only the model that best fits your specific business situation. Below are tailored recommendations based on common buyer profiles in the Southeast Asian market.
Supply Model Selection Guide by Buyer Profile
| Buyer Profile | Recommended Model | Rationale | Key Actions |
|---|
| Startup / New Market Entrant | In-Stock (with optional logo) | Minimal capital risk; fast time-to-market; validate demand before committing to custom | Order 100-500 pieces; test market response; gather customer feedback; iterate |
| Small Business (Steady Demand) | In-Stock + Semi-Custom | Balance cost efficiency with brand differentiation; moderate MOQ (500-1,000) | Negotiate logo/branding on existing products; build 2-3 month inventory buffer |
| Growing Brand (Scaling Production) | OEM Custom (Standard Specs) | Lower per-unit cost at scale; consistent quality; brand control | Commit to 2,000-5,000 MOQ; establish batch consistency agreements; schedule quarterly production runs |
| Established Manufacturer (High Volume) | OEM Custom (Full Specs) | Maximum cost efficiency; complete specification control; long-term supplier partnerships | Negotiate 10,000+ MOQ for best pricing; invest in mold ownership; implement supplier QC audits |
| Urgent / Emergency Orders | In-Stock Only | 2-4 week delivery vs 2-4 months for OEM; critical for production line continuity | Identify 3-5 verified In-Stock suppliers; maintain contact for rapid reordering |

The Hybrid Approach: Many successful buyers on Alibaba.com use a phased strategy that evolves with their business:
Phase 1 (Market Testing): Start with In-Stock items (100-500 pieces) to validate product specifications and customer demand. Use this phase to identify any quality issues or specification adjustments needed.
Phase 2 (Semi-Custom): Once demand is proven, move to semi-custom production (500-1,000 pieces) with your logo/branding on existing product specs. This builds brand identity without full mold investment.
Phase 3 (Full OEM): When order volumes consistently exceed 2,000-5,000 pieces, transition to full OEM custom production. Negotiate mold ownership, batch consistency agreements, and preferential pricing.
Phase 4 (Strategic Partnership): At 10,000+ piece annual volumes, establish long-term partnerships with 1-2 core suppliers. Implement joint quality control processes, shared forecasting, and exclusive product development.

Action Checklist for First-Time Buyers on Alibaba.com:
✓ Verify supplier Gold Member status (minimum 3 years)
✓ Request material grade certificates (304/316L stainless steel)
✓ Order samples before bulk production (even if sample cost exceeds unit price)
✓ Use Trade Assurance for payment protection
✓ Specify exact tolerances, surface finish, and packaging requirements in writing
✓ For OEM: require batch consistency agreement and third-party inspection
✓ For In-Stock: confirm actual inventory levels and lead times before ordering
✓ Compare at least 5-10 suppliers before making final decision
